服务器挂机与服务器挂机项目
一、服务器挂机的概念与原理
在当今数字化时代,服务器挂机成为了一个备受关注的话题。服务器挂机,简单来说,就是让服务器在无人值守的情况下持续运行,执行特定的任务或提供特定的服务。这种技术在许多领域都有广泛的应用,例如数据处理、网络爬虫、虚拟货币挖矿等。
服务器挂机的原理基于计算机系统的自动化运行能力。通过编写脚本或使用特定的软件,我们可以设置服务器在特定的时间或条件下自动启动,并执行预定的任务。这些任务可以是周期性的,也可以是根据实时数据进行触发的。服务器挂机的核心目标是提高效率,节省人力成本,并确保任务的持续执行。
为了实现服务器挂机,我们需要考虑多个因素。首先,服务器的硬件性能是至关重要的。强大的处理器、充足的内存和稳定的网络连接是保证服务器能够长时间稳定运行的基础。其次,我们需要选择合适的操作系统和软件环境。不同的任务可能需要不同的操作系统和软件支持,因此在选择时需要根据具体需求进行评估。此外,安全性也是不可忽视的一个方面。服务器挂机意味着服务器将长时间暴露在网络环境中,因此需要采取有效的安全措施来防止黑客攻击和数据泄露。
总之,服务器挂机是一种利用计算机系统自动化能力的技术手段,通过合理的配置和管理,可以为各种应用场景提供高效、稳定的服务。
二、服务器挂机项目的类型与应用
服务器挂机项目的类型多种多样,根据不同的需求和目标,可以分为以下几种主要类型:
1. 数据处理项目:在大数据时代,数据处理是一项重要的任务。服务器挂机可以用于数据的采集、清洗、分析和存储。例如,通过网络爬虫技术,服务器可以自动抓取互联网上的信息,并进行整理和分析,为企业提供市场调研、竞争分析等方面的支持。
2. 虚拟货币挖矿项目:随着虚拟货币的兴起,挖矿成为了一种获取虚拟货币的方式。服务器挂机可以用于运行挖矿软件,通过计算能力来解决数学难题,从而获得虚拟货币的奖励。然而,需要注意的是,虚拟货币挖矿存在一定的风险和法律问题,在参与此类项目时需要谨慎考虑。
3. 游戏挂机项目:对于一些在线游戏,玩家可能希望通过挂机来获取游戏资源或提升角色等级。服务器挂机可以模拟玩家的操作,自动进行游戏任务,从而节省玩家的时间和精力。但是,这种行为可能违反游戏的使用规则,导致账号被封禁等问题,因此需要谨慎使用。
4. 网站监控与维护项目:服务器挂机可以用于监控网站的运行状态,及时发现并解决问题。例如,通过定期发送请求并检查响应,服务器可以检测网站是否正常运行,是否存在漏洞或故障。同时,服务器挂机还可以用于自动备份网站数据,确保数据的安全性和完整性。
服务器挂机项目的应用领域非常广泛,不仅可以为个人用户提供便利,还可以为企业和组织带来实际的经济效益。然而,在实施服务器挂机项目时,需要根据法律法规和道德规范进行操作,避免对他人和社会造成不良影响。
三、服务器挂机的优势与风险
服务器挂机作为一种技术手段,具有许多优势。首先,它可以实现自动化操作,减少人工干预,提高工作效率。通过设置好的脚本和程序,服务器可以在无人值守的情况下自动完成任务,节省了人力成本和时间成本。其次,服务器挂机可以实现长时间的连续运行,确保任务的及时性和稳定性。相比于人工操作,服务器不会受到疲劳、情绪等因素的影响,能够更加可靠地执行任务。此外,服务器挂机还可以利用服务器的强大计算能力和存储能力,处理大量的数据和复杂的任务,提高工作质量和效果。
然而,服务器挂机也存在一些风险。首先,服务器挂机需要消耗大量的资源,包括电力、网络带宽和硬件设备等。如果不合理规划和管理,可能会导致资源浪费和成本增加。其次,服务器挂机可能会面临安全风险,如黑客攻击、病毒感染和数据泄露等。如果服务器的安全防护措施不到位,可能会给用户和企业带来严重的损失。此外,服务器挂机还可能会违反一些法律法规和服务条款,如滥用网络资源、侵犯知识产权等。因此,在进行服务器挂机时,需要遵守相关法律法规和道德规范,确保合法合规地使用服务器资源。
综上所述,服务器挂机具有一定的优势,但也存在一些风险。在实施服务器挂机项目时,需要充分考虑其优势和风险,制定合理的方案和措施,以实现最大化的效益和最小化的风险。
四、如何选择合适的服务器挂机方案
选择合适的服务器挂机方案是确保服务器挂机项目成功实施的关键。以下是一些在选择服务器挂机方案时需要考虑的因素:
1. 需求分析:首先,需要明确服务器挂机项目的具体需求,包括任务类型、数据量、计算需求、运行时间等。根据这些需求,选择适合的服务器类型和配置。
2. 服务器性能:服务器的性能是影响服务器挂机效果的重要因素。需要考虑服务器的处理器性能、内存容量、存储容量、网络带宽等因素。选择性能强劲的服务器可以提高任务的执行效率和稳定性。
3. 操作系统和软件:选择适合的操作系统和软件也是非常重要的。不同的操作系统和软件对服务器挂机的支持程度不同,需要根据具体需求进行选择。例如,对于数据处理项目,可能需要选择支持数据分析和处理软件的操作系统;对于虚拟货币挖矿项目,可能需要选择支持挖矿软件的操作系统。
4. 成本效益:服务器挂机项目需要投入一定的成本,包括服务器租赁费用、电力费用、网络费用等。在选择服务器挂机方案时,需要综合考虑成本和效益,选择性价比高的方案。
5. 安全性:服务器挂机项目需要考虑安全性问题。选择具有良好安全性能的服务器和操作系统,并采取有效的安全措施,如安装防火墙、杀毒软件、加密数据等,以防止黑客攻击和数据泄露。
6. 技术支持:选择提供良好技术支持的服务器提供商和软件开发商。在服务器挂机过程中,可能会遇到各种技术问题,需要及时得到技术支持和解决。
综上所述,选择合适的服务器挂机方案需要综合考虑需求分析、服务器性能、操作系统和软件、成本效益、安全性和技术支持等因素。只有选择了合适的方案,才能确保服务器挂机项目的顺利实施和成功运行。
五、服务器挂机项目的管理与监控
服务器挂机项目的成功实施不仅需要选择合适的方案,还需要进行有效的管理和监控。以下是一些在服务器挂机项目管理和监控方面的要点:
1. 任务管理:明确服务器挂机项目的任务目标和要求,制定详细的任务计划和流程。将任务分解为具体的子任务,并分配给相应的人员或系统进行执行。同时,建立任务跟踪和反馈机制,及时了解任务的进展情况,发现问题并及时解决。
2. 资源管理:合理分配服务器资源,包括计算资源、存储资源和网络资源等。根据任务的需求和优先级,动态调整资源分配,确保资源的充分利用和高效运行。同时,监控资源的使用情况,及时发现资源瓶颈和浪费现象,采取相应的措施进行优化。
3. 性能监控:建立服务器性能监控体系,实时监测服务器的性能指标,如 CPU 利用率、内存使用率、磁盘 I/O 等。通过性能监控数据,及时发现服务器性能问题,并进行优化和调整。同时,根据性能监控数据,预测服务器的负载情况,提前做好资源扩容和优化的准备。
4. 安全管理:加强服务器的安全管理,采取有效的安全措施,如设置防火墙、安装杀毒软件、加密数据等,防止黑客攻击和数据泄露。同时,定期进行安全漏洞扫描和修复,确保服务器的安全性。
5. 日志管理:建立完善的日志管理体系,记录服务器挂机项目的运行日志、操作日志和错误日志等。通过日志分析,及时发现问题和异常情况,并进行排查和解决。同时,日志还可以作为审计和追溯的依据,确保服务器挂机项目的合规性和可追溯性。
总之,服务器挂机项目的管理和监控是确保项目成功实施的重要保障。通过有效的管理和监控,可以提高服务器挂机项目的运行效率和稳定性,降低风险和成本,实现项目的预期目标。